What ecommerce platforms does Toimi develop on for Pearland businesses?

We build on WooCommerce, Shopify, and custom-developed platforms depending on your catalog complexity, integration requirements, and long-term development roadmap. For Pearland businesses with straightforward product catalogs and standard checkout flows, WooCommerce or Shopify deliver a fast, maintainable foundation. For businesses in manufacturing or life sciences with complex pricing tiers, account-based access, or ERP integration requirements, a custom-built platform gives the development team full control over business logic that off-the-shelf solutions cannot accommodate without significant workarounds.

How do you handle payment and shipping integration for a Pearland ecommerce store?

We integrate standard payment gateways — Stripe, PayPal, Apple Pay, Google Pay — alongside shipping carriers and rate calculators configured for your actual fulfillment setup. For Pearland businesses distributing across Brazoria County, the Greater Houston metro, and national markets, shipping zone configuration, real-time rate calculation, and multi-warehouse fulfillment routing are mapped during the technical scoping phase so the checkout experience reflects your actual logistics operation rather than a generic shipping setup that creates fulfillment problems after launch.

How do you approach bilingual ecommerce for Pearland businesses?

Pearland's diverse Brazoria County customer base — with significant Spanish-speaking communities across the area — makes bilingual English-Spanish storefronts a common requirement for consumer-facing businesses. We implement bilingual ecommerce with proper hreflang tags, independently optimized product descriptions in each language, and localized checkout flows rather than auto-translated content that erodes trust at the point of purchase. For Pearland retailers where Spanish-speaking customers represent a meaningful share of transactions, bilingual implementation is treated as a core project deliverable with its own content brief.
